X-Git-Url: https://www.tinc-vpn.org/git/browse?a=blobdiff_plain;f=Makefile.am;h=a09ee4dad8a383aa5df51ea8c3cdd45714109ba2;hb=72136f8418bc7e8a0a5bf3c11215aa49dc679659;hp=0667a877e07094e617eb2c7d73147e980368a2bf;hpb=27c304940a5dbe83fb0f655c5c43150bafed3b63;p=tinc diff --git a/Makefile.am b/Makefile.am index 0667a877..a09ee4da 100644 --- a/Makefile.am +++ b/Makefile.am @@ -2,17 +2,24 @@ AUTOMAKE_OPTIONS = gnu -SUBDIRS = m4 lib src doc po +SUBDIRS = src doc test systemd -ACLOCAL_AMFLAGS = -I m4 +ACLOCAL_AMFLAGS = -I m4 -EXTRA_DIST = config.rpath mkinstalldirs system.h COPYING.README depcomp +EXTRA_DIST = COPYING.README README.android -ChangeLog: - svn log > ChangeLog +@CODE_COVERAGE_RULES@ + +# If git describe works, force autoconf to run in order to make sure we have the +# current version number from git in the resulting configure script. +configure-version: + -cd $(srcdir) && git describe && autoconf --force -svn-clean: maintainer-clean - svn status --no-ignore | sed -n 's/^[?I] \+//p' | tr '\012' '\0' | xargs -r0 rm -rf +# Triggering the README target means we are building a distribution (make dist). +README: configure-version + +ChangeLog: + (cd $(srcdir) && git log) > ChangeLog deb: dpkg-buildpackage -rfakeroot @@ -26,5 +33,8 @@ release: rm -f ChangeLog $(MAKE) ChangeLog echo "Please edit the NEWS file now..." - /usr/bin/editor NEWS + /usr/bin/editor $(srcdir)/NEWS $(MAKE) dist + +astyle: + astyle --options=.astylerc -nQ src/*.[ch] src/*/*.[ch] test/*.[ch]